NEW DELHI: The University of Delhi received more than 2 lakh registrations for undergraduate (UG) admission 2023 till 6 pm today. The DU Common Seat Allocation System (DU CSAS) portal was activated on June 14. Candidates who appeared in the Common University Entrance Test (CUET UG 2023) exam will have to complete the DU admission registration process through the official website, ugadmission.uod.ac.in.
As per the latest update, a total of 2,07,683 candidates registered. Of which, 1,41,883 submitted the DU application form 2023 and 65,800 did not submit the form.
The admission to UG programmes will be based on the CUET scores 2023 and other eligibility criteria set by the university.
Meanwhile, the DU School of Open Learning (SOL) began the postgraduate (PG) admission registration process today at sol.du.ac.in. Candidates will not require a CUET PG score to be eligible for admission at DU SOL. The university offers a total of 6 PG courses.
As per the DU application fee, candidates belonging to general category will have to pay Rs 250 and reserved category candidates will have to pay Rs 100.

How to register for DU UG admission 2023
Students will have to register at the DU CSAS admission portal by following the steps given below to be considered for admission. Once the CUET results 2023 are declared, they will have to then enter their marks on the portal.
- Visit the DU CSAS portal, ugadmission.uod.ac.in 2023.
- Click on ‘New Registration’ if applying for the first time.
- If not, enter the registration number and password generated to fill the form.
- For new users, candidates will have to enter a valid e-mail address to generate a password.
- Now enter personal and academic details asked for in the form.
- Upload the document required in the specified format.
- Pay the application fee based on the category opted for.
- Review the DU registration form and submit.
- Download the confirmation page for future reference.
